silence |

silence peaceful and pleasant, a salve for the soul obliterates cares, leaves one feeling whole tension defuses, faith and hope increase lack of noise can allow troubles' surcease but atmosphere pregnant, angry words unsaid hang heavy, surrounding with sense of dread breath constricted from fearing what may be I'm cowering in lonely misery then my whole world tilts to never be the same for you finally speak... and say her name ~~~~ 3/05 |
